Php 如何使用date_FORMAT()对日期进行排序?
我的Mysql查询Php 如何使用date_FORMAT()对日期进行排序?,php,mysql,sql,database,Php,Mysql,Sql,Database,我的Mysql查询 select DATE_FORMAT(max(lastmodified), '%d %M %y , %r') from client_log 我的实际输出是 我想要结果6月15日16日02:17:09PM,我必须在php逻辑中应用这个顺序概念,但在这里我不知道如何在date_format()函数中执行,或者在timestamp字段中是否有mysql可用的函数?问题是%d,应该是%d 试试这种格式 select DATE_FORMAT(max(lastmodified),
select DATE_FORMAT(max(lastmodified), '%d %M %y , %r') from client_log
我的实际输出是
我想要结果6月15日16日02:17:09PM,我必须在php逻辑中应用这个顺序概念,但在这里我不知道如何在date_format()函数中执行,或者在timestamp字段中是否有mysql可用的函数?问题是%d,应该是%d 试试这种格式
select DATE_FORMAT(max(lastmodified), '%D %M %y , %r') from client_log
那么,您正在寻找PHP方法来实现同样的功能?只从数据库中获取所需格式的数据通常比让PHP重新处理信息容易/快得多。
select DATE_FORMAT(max(lastmodified), '%D %M %y , %r') from client_log